I agree with the above poster, although I was an agent for Farepak for 15 years, and actually did a bit with Park for a couple of years as well. I will never, ever as long as I live put money into another hamper/voucher company.
I really would urge anyone thinking of joining one of the other companies in 2007 as either a customer or agent to think twice. I thought the fact that they were affiliated to HITA, would make my money safe, and the company was reputable. There is NOT enough legislation for these companies to operate properly, and in fact rules for the remaining companies should be brought forward FAST, so this never happens again.
At work we are all going to pay into a Social Club Account each payday next year, keep a ledger with payment details, and pay out the money in November 2007, with interest. Staff can pay as much or as little as they want.:j0 -
